Skip to content

Conversation

@github-actions
Copy link
Contributor

This is an automated pull request to merge tofik/update-ui-task-comments-sidebar into dev.
It was created by the [Auto Pull Request] action.

@vercel
Copy link

vercel bot commented Dec 24, 2025

The latest updates on your projects. Learn more about Vercel for GitHub.

Project Deployment Review Updated (UTC)
app Ready Ready Preview, Comment Dec 24, 2025 6:15am
1 Skipped Deployment
Project Deployment Review Updated (UTC)
portal Skipped Skipped Dec 24, 2025 6:15am

@cursor
Copy link

cursor bot commented Dec 24, 2025

PR Summary

Vendor risk assessment overhaul

  • API: Replace firecrawlExtractVendorData with firecrawlAgentVendorRiskAssessment using @mendable/firecrawl-js; add agent-schema, typed results, and normalize URLs/dates
  • Task description: Generate and store structured vendorRiskAssessmentV1 JSON (includes risk level, assessment, links, certifications, news)

App UI for generated tasks

  • New renderer for Vendor Risk Assessment tasks with summary metrics, useful links, certifications card, and news timeline
  • Detects vendor risk tasks via structured JSON or legacy TipTap content

Task detail UX improvements

  • Sidebar can collapse/expand; compact icon-only mode when collapsed
  • Create Task dialog widened and made scrollable
  • Editable title/description components accept styling, improve blur/save behavior, and ensure onChange fires after file drop/paste; avoid editor re-creation during upload; better overflow hinting
  • Comment editor styling: remove border to match background

Written by Cursor Bugbot for commit 463cd2d. This will update automatically on new commits. Configure here.

@graphite-app
Copy link

graphite-app bot commented Dec 24, 2025

Graphite Automations

"Auto-assign PRs to Author" took an action on this PR • (12/24/25)

1 reviewer was added to this PR based on Mariano Fuentes's automation.

@vercel vercel bot temporarily deployed to Preview – portal December 24, 2025 06:13 Inactive
@tofikwest tofikwest merged commit 154ca39 into main Dec 24, 2025
11 checks passed
@tofikwest tofikwest deleted the tofik/update-ui-task-comments-sidebar branch December 24, 2025 06:18
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ants